General Information

The Battery takes part in Living History, Reenactment, Memorial services, Civil War Grave Marker restoration and Battlefield preservation.  We take great pride in what we have accomplished and how we portray our Civil War ancestors during events but we also realize that this is a hobby and is meant to be fun and we strive to do it Historically correct.
We are a very family oriented unit, several times during the year our families attend events with us, but majority of the time it's just the men.  We try to attend an event each month but on occasion we will have an event every weekend or every other weekend but members are not required to attend every event.
We are also a Horse drawn artillery unit, which means that we can pull our gun and limber with horses. We are associated with Captain Lumsden's (Oestenstad) Birmingham, AL horse drawn artillery unit and during the National Reenactments we fall in with them. PLEASE!! understand that you don't have to be a horse expert to join us.  Majority of the members fall in and man the artillery piece.
We try to hold artillery and horse drills a couple of times during the year, but that depends on how active we are during that time.  We hold a company meeting the first of the year, where we elect new officers for the up coming campaign and pay annual dues. Note: Members who attend events are also required to pay a event fee which helps pay for hauling and towing the artillery piece & horse's and other materials to and from events.

Membership Information

If it sounds like a interesting hobby in which you would like to join, Stanford's Battery is always looking for new members.  We have some uniform materials in which you may use during events until you are able to purchase your own.  We do require that you attend at least one living history and/or one reenactment before you are officially enlisted into the Battery.  All member nominees will be voted in or not by Active members of the battery.
